I've got a clean install of 8.04 up and running fine on a single 200G drive (/dev/sdc) on a machine I'm going to use as a media server. I've added 2 500G drives connected to a Sil3112 card and those are configured fine - they showed up automatically as /dev/sda and /dev/sdb, and I configured them as RAID 1. I want to add a similar pair of drives (with room for more in the future) in an external enclosure; the machine also has an Addonics Sil3124 controller connected to one of their port multipliers.

I was under the impression that under newer kernels the multiplier was supported and both drives should be recognized, not just the first one on the PMP that the BIOS recognizes. Unfortunately this isn't happening - Ubuntu sees /dev/sdd but no /dev/sde. Is there some further configuration I need to do?

I've run into the same problem in 8.04. I would try installing Fedora 9 and see if it works in there. I think it's the kernel version of hardy that is causing you the issue. Ubuntu is kernel 2.6.24 and fedora 9 is 2.6.25 so see if that makes a difference

The way software RAID works using SI controllers and port multipliers (PM) is that, you use mdadm to see and configure as a raid volume all 5 drives connected to the PM. If the PM is connected to non-PM aware controller card (legacy) it will only detect one drive out of the 5.

But using a Hardware Port Multiplier which uses an integrated hardware controller, the raid setup is done on the HPM itself. So once you connect it to a SATA port, it will be seen as a single RAID volume.
